Budgam By-Polls: NC, PDP, BJP, others file nominations for key election | KNO

Budgam, Oct 20 (KNO): Candidates from all major political parties, including the National Conference (NC),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) and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P), along with several independents, filed their nomination papers on Monday for the upcoming Budgam Assembly by-election — the last day for filing nominations. According to details available with the news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O), National Conference (NC) candidate Aga Syed Mehmood, accompanied by Chief Minister Omar Abdullah, submitted his nomination papers before the Returning Officer (RO) in Budgam.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) candidate Aga Syed Muntazir Mehdi was joined by MLA Waheed Rehman Parra while filing his nomination papers. Similarly, BJP candidate Aga Syed Mohsin also filed his nomination papers today in the presence of Leader of Opposition (LoP) in Legislative Assembly, Sunil Sharma. Apart from major parties, several other candidates entered the fray. Former Apni Party leader Muntazir Mohiuddin filed his papers as an independent candidate after resigning from the party. Former DDC Chairman Budgam Nazir Ahmad Khan filed his nomination from the Awami Ittehad Party (AIP) led by Engineer Rashid, while Aam Aadmi Party’s (AAP) Kashmir Vice President Deeba Khan also submitted her papers. Jammu and Kashmir Apni Party’s Mukhtar Ahmad Dar filed his nomination papers. He was accompanied by former Chadoora MLA Javaid Mustafa Mir. A few other independent candidates also filed nominations on the final day. The Budgam by-election is scheduled for November 11, with counting to take place on November 14. The by-poll was necessitated after Chief Minister Omar Abdullah vacated the Budgam seat, opting to retain his traditional stronghold of Ganderbal following his dual victory in the 2024 Assembly elections—(KNO)
